Simple Methods to Remove Melasma

Melasma can be treated either orally or with laser surgery. Since melasma is often triggered by endocrine imbalance, laser therapy effectively fragments and breaks down melanin pigment in the dermis, enabling rapid clearance of melasma. Oral medications may also help correct underlying endocrine dysfunction.

Melasma is commonly associated with factors such as elevated estrogen levels, oral contraceptive use, impaired liver function, menstrual irregularities, UV exposure (sun tanning), psychological stress, and chronic kidney disease. Topical treatments include tretinoin cream or arbutin cream. In traditional Chinese medicine (TCM), formulas such as Liu Wei Di Huang Wan (Rehmannia Six Formula) and Xiao Yao Wan (Free and Easy Wanderer Pills) may be prescribed, with treatment individualized according to the specific etiology. Beyond pharmacotherapy and photonic treatments, daily sun protection plays a crucial role in managing melasma. Complete resolution of melasma requires a comprehensive, long-term skin management strategy—only through integrated, sustained treatment can melasma be fully eliminated and recurrence prevented.

Maintain a nutritionally balanced diet rich in fruits and vegetables, especially foods high in vitamin C—such as lemons, hawthorn berries, bayberries, green peppers, tomatoes, and citrus fruits—which may benefit melasma management.
